Day After Day
tsurezure naru mamani...
ANOTHER DECADE

from 2021 when it's begining after/with CORONA Virus.

Windows11で DireWolf を使ってみる

12月
24
2025
Back
HOME


一度使ってみたいと思っていた DireWolf。 CubeSat「BOTAN」の CAM データ受信を期にセットアップしてみることにした。

以前 Ubuntu にインストールしては居るのだけど、システム全体が稼働していないので、初めての運用と言って良い状態である。

DireWolf Windows版のダウンロードとインストール



  1. 先ず、画像をクリックして GITHUB より
    direwolf-1.8.1-a231971_x86_64.zip(今日現在)
    をダウンロードする。

  2. ZIPを解凍して出来たフォルダを適当な場所に移動すればインストールは完了である。

設定ファイルの編集


  1. フォルダ内の設定ファイル direwolf.conf をバックアップし必要最小限の設定をした音源別のファイルを作成する。

  2. 先ず必要となるのがデバイス番号である。今回は①の IC-7100(この名前はサウンドの設定で書き換えてある)で設定する。

    Available audio input devices for receive (*=selected):
        0: Microphone (Polycom Communicato
     *  1: IC-7100 Rx (4- USB Audio CODEC    (channel 0)
        2: Mic In (Realtek(R) Audio)
        3: IC-9700 Rx (2- USB Audio CODEC
        4: CABLE Output (VB-Audio Virtual
    Available audio output devices for transmit (*=selected):
     *  0: SP Out (Realtek(R) Audio)   (channel 0)
        1: CABLE Input (VB-Audio Virtual C
        2: IC-7100 Tx (4- USB Audio CODEC
        3: Inner SP (Realtek(R) Audio)
        4: Speeker (Polycom Communicator)
        5: IC-9700 Tx (2- USB Audio CODEC
     メモ帳
    ADEVICE 1 0
    ARATE 48000
    CHANNEL 0
    KISSPORT 8100       # 通常は 8001 になっているが使用するアプリによって変更できる
    

  3. dw_ic7100.conf のようにソースが判別しやすい名前で保存する。他にも設定しておきたい無線機などが有れば ADEVICE の番号を変えて別名保存する。

設定ファイルを指定した内容でバッチファイルを作成


  1. このバッチファイル内でその他のオプションを指定する

  2. @echo off
    cd /d C:\Users\USER\Desktop\direwolf-1.8.1-a231971_x86_64
    direwolf -c dw_ic7100.conf -r 48000 -B 4800 -g -t 0 -q hd -a 5
    
    ・フォルダ内に移動する
    ・direwolf起動コマンドに続き -c で IC-7100 用設定ファイルを指定
    ・-r 48000 は設定ファイルでサンプルレートの指定は行っているので不要だが上書きできる。
    ・-B 4800 で 4800 bps を指定している
    ・-g を指定しないとガウシアンフィルタとならない (G3RUH)
    ・-t 0 テキストのみ表示 (1: 色分け表示)
    ・-q hd h:Heard行表示オフ d:APRS詳細表示オフ(別々に指定可
    ・-a 0 オーディオステータス非表示 5: 5秒ごとに表示(秒数変更可)

  3. dw_gmsk_4800_g3ruh.bat のような特定しやすいファイル名で保存する。


  4. 後は、ショートカットを作成して自由なネーミングでスタートメニューなどに登録すれば起動しやすくなる。


Back
HOME